Output 26c6a829a93deafa19aa839364e34c292fbeed38d35604eec02bf65a6a77369e:2

value
21947776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e45e359744d7018d202b72e1a809bb746f9ee0 OP_EQUAL
address
MTDYPCBTtbb6dtGdDz7Go3jdE71pd6V54u
transaction
26c6a829a93deafa19aa839364e34c292fbeed38d35604eec02bf65a6a77369e
spent
true